String
Specifies a particular Facility Action for the flexible button. No facility
action will be taken for the button if the string is empty or invalid.
Only the following values are available:
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_DN, X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_HEADSET,
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_CONTACT,
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_ONETOUCH
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_DN
String
Optional argument associated with the specified Facility Action for the
flexible button.
Max. 32 characters
Note
The value range differs depending on the flexible button set in
"FLEX_BUTTON_FACILITY_ACTx", as follows:
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_DN: 1–32 (ringtone number)
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_HEADSET: not available
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_CONTACT: 1–32 digit number
X_PANASONIC_IPTEL_ONETOUCH: 1–32 digit number
For details about flexible buttons, refer to the Operating Instructions
on the Panasonic Web site (® see Introduction).
1,1
String
Specifies the message to be displayed on the screen when the flexible
button is pressed.
Note
You can use Unicode characters for this setting.
Max. 10 characters or 30 bytes
Empty string
